Prior to getting the PP's into the elevator I had them in the lower chamber (since that door locks) that the big platform elevator drops to after the bugger battle.

From there, once the jet pack elites are dead you double wield them, and drop into the elevator that goes to the bomb room without going far enough in to trigger the vator downward. Typically it is faster to swap both for one of hte dead jet pack elite PR's, and leave 2 each time, then swap the PR for two more. There comes a point where you are just dropping one into the elevator and carrying one, when you run out of PR's to carry back.

I did notice that when the elevator to the bomb room does its jiggly dance down that the PP's floated a bit, and that scared me thinking I might lose them. When we hit bottom they just dropped to the floor. I got them all out of hte vator by double wielding and dropping so that I did not have to expose myself each time I needed to swap for a new one. With Angry going that trip to the open doored elevator is rather dangerous!

With Cairo down I moved on to Outskirts. The parts up to and past the alley to Zanzibar were tough but not undoable. Past strategies helped alot in making it beatable.

The real problem is how the skull combo affects the Ghosts. They are -blam!- damn near indestructable!

Things that seem patently unfair and way stacked against the MC in vehicle combat:

1-It takes more than 6 Rockets to take out a ghost. I know since I hit the same ghost with a FULL CLIP of 6 rockets and it was still moving around and firing at me. The effect of Mythic seems to extend to most vehicles that the elite is driving EXCEPT the troop carriers in the tunnel (at least getting that first explosion, after that taking out the driver it can take forever due to Mythic). Banshees, Wraiths and Ghosts all are damn near impossible to kill without dying alot unless you are firing from a ghost at long range, out of their range, and have nothing shooting at you.

2-The effects of the skulls related to vehicles are MUCH more noticeable on my vehicle than the enemy. With Angry and Sputnik, a ghosts shots move the warthog or my ghost around a ton, whereas when I fire from a ghost, at another ghost, or even hit a friendly hog, nothing happens like that, they do not move in any way other than under their own power. They are still subject to explosions moving them under Sputniks awesome power, but the weapons fire seemingly has not a whit of effect on them like it does on me.

3-A beam or sniper rifle shot to the fuel tank will still take out a ghost, if you can get a clean shot. The amount of movement seems to double at least with this skull combo, they do not spend much time dawdling and giving you clear shots on that tank. Even if you do manage to get them out of the ghost, they are tough to make dead. You can go through over a third to half of a beam rifle to take one of these steroided up elites out, or a ghost firing on him for over ten seconds.........and there are alot of elites on the second half of OS!

I just got back from Cairo Station LASO practice. After excruciating, agonizing, hair pulling moments (and a heck lot of screaming, raging, cursing, and weeping), I have a new, better strategy for the first hangar room.

My new strategy calls for map control, just like in the bomb room. I had doubts this kind of strategy existed in the first hangar. I also doubted that I could pull it off, but having survived my first playthrough with no overshields (and often, with my normal shields down), I can safely say that it's a viable option. It requires a ton of patience though and you really should headshot every single Grunt before attempting it.

With this strategy, there's no need for Johnson.

I'm getting the videos ready (might take a while) so I'll just provide some screenshots.

Basically, you headshot all the Grunts then stick all of the Elites (especially the dual wielding Elite) to get them to pull out swords or go into melee mode then you show yourself from this position to 1 at a time. He charges. Blam! Assassination. When dealing with sword Elites, just cloak and use cover to hinder his view. Delta Halo ended up not being too awful once I got past the buggers.

Regret's jackal snipers were a real handful with cowbell on, but overall not too much trouble.

Where I have run into trouble were two specific spots, one surmounted, the other currently giving me indigestion!

1-The second gondola ride, where you match wits with the banshees, 2 jet pack elites and fuel rod grunts, yeah that one took almost 30 attempts before I could manage to get that checkpoint. I kept getting killed due to never being able to battle and then hide effectively before one of the three bastard categoires of evil aliens got me. I was saving the rocket rounds since all of them wont even take out one banshee, so why bother, and saved them to attack the gondola and sight up on any too nosy jet packer. I finally was able to kill the FRC grunts first, then basically just run around and cloak until the checkpoint went. You cant do the run around strategy when the FRC grunts are still alive, they lay you to waste (or just blow you off of your gondola to the watery death below). The jet pack elites got their death when they held up at the temple of regret.

2-I am currently trying to dispatch the Prophet of Regret and Mythic seems to have made him damn near invincible. I have gotten the first series of three checkpoints after beating on him for the appropriate amount of time, but I have found that he has grown rather obnoxiously strong since that point. I have gotten to him and landed six punches as many as ten more times (total of 60 MC fists to the head) before getting killed and he still will not go down and -blam!- die!
